Self-consequence and Smugness

Self-consequence

Self-consequence noun - An exaggerated sense of one's importance that shows itself in the making of excessive or unjustified claims.
Usage example: had the self-consequence of someone who was born wealthy and never had to work a day in his life

Smugness and self-consequence are semantically related. In some cases you can use "Smugness" instead a noun phrase "Self-consequence".

Smugness

Smugness noun - An often unjustified feeling of being pleased with oneself or with one's situation or achievements.

Self-consequence and smugness are semantically related. Sometimes you can use "Self-consequence" instead a noun "Smugness".
